orbiter 536e77e8b7 modifications towards a single database operation to read/write http header and cached file at once:
- removed distinction between header file types for http and ftp; ftp is simulated by using http properties
- removed all old resourceInfo classes that handled this distinction
- introduced a new distinction between http request and http response objects
- unified new response objects with two other object types that had been introduced elsewhere
- changed all servlet call methods to use the new http request header object type
- divided static object keys for http header properties into request and response types
- refactoring here and there (a large number of type changes and many methods merged/moved)

package xml;
import java.util.Iterator;
import java.util.Map;
import de.anomic.http.httpRequestHeader;
import de.anomic.plasma.plasmaSwitchboard;
import de.anomic.plasma.plasmaWebStructure;
import de.anomic.server.serverObjects;
import de.anomic.server.serverSwitch;
public class webstructure {
public static serverObjects respond(final httpRequestHeader header, final serverObjects post, final serverSwitch<?> env) {
final serverObjects prop = new serverObjects();
final plasmaSwitchboard sb = (plasmaSwitchboard) env;
final boolean latest = ((post == null) ? false : post.containsKey("latest"));
final Iterator<plasmaWebStructure.structureEntry> i = sb.webStructure.structureEntryIterator(latest);
int c = 0, d;
plasmaWebStructure.structureEntry sentry;
Map.Entry<String, Integer> refentry;
String refdom, refhash;
Integer refcount;
Iterator<Map.Entry<String, Integer>> k;
while (i.hasNext()) {
sentry = i.next();
prop.put("domains_" + c + "_hash", sentry.domhash);
prop.put("domains_" + c + "_domain", sentry.domain);
prop.put("domains_" + c + "_date", sentry.date);
k = sentry.references.entrySet().iterator();
d = 0;
refloop: while (k.hasNext()) {
refentry = k.next();
refhash = refentry.getKey();
refdom = sb.webStructure.resolveDomHash2DomString(refhash);
if (refdom == null) continue refloop;
prop.put("domains_" + c + "_citations_" + d + "_refhash", refhash);
prop.put("domains_" + c + "_citations_" + d + "_refdom", refdom);
refcount = refentry.getValue();
prop.put("domains_" + c + "_citations_" + d + "_refcount", refcount.intValue());
d++;
}
prop.put("domains_" + c + "_citations", d);
c++;
}
prop.put("domains", c);
prop.put("maxref", plasmaWebStructure.maxref);
if (latest) sb.webStructure.joinOldNew();
// return rewrite properties
return prop;
}
}
